## Abstract Reaction of isoselenocyanates with hydrazine or aryl hydrazines generates the corresponding selenosemicarbazides which are coupled with ethyl chloroacetate to yield 1,3โselenazolidinโ4โones (III) and (VI).
Selective synthesis of novel 2-imino-1,3-selenazolidin-4-ones and 2-amino-1,3,4-selenadiazin-5-ones from isoselenocyanates

โฆ Synopsis
An efficient and regioselective synthesis of 2-imino-1,3-selenazolidin-4-ones and 2-amino-1,3,4-selenadiazin-5-ones was achieved via one-pot reaction of isoselenocyanates, hydrazines, and ethyl chloroacetate or chloroacetyl chloride, respectively. Plausible mechanisms for these transformations were given.
